Python Job: platform Engineer - Python

Job added on

Company

Capgemini

Location

Southend-on-Sea, England - United Kingdom

Job type

Full-Time

Python Job Details

Platform Engineer

6 months

Southend/Remote


Capgemini mandated PAYE


Seeking a candidate with Python and web developer with DevOps experience; Candidate Must be from a development background with strong Object Oriental Programme (OPS) skills and who must have worked in python with frameworks like Flask/Django/FastAPI.


Jenkins (scripted and declarative pipelines) - Candidate must have a very strong day-day user knowledge of Jenkins and a day-to-day experience of writing pipelines in Jenkins files. Candidate is required to work Client Side within the existing Architect and Environment Team, that has a mixture of Capgemini, Contractors, SREs and HMRC resources.


Note: Day to day experience of using the mandatory tools is very vital. We are not interested in a candidate who can just do a generic button clicking tasks/experience without knowing how to write, configure or reconfiguration hence candidate with a programming background is required for this role.


Brief Description of Tasks to perform This role requires a professional who is well experienced and knowledgeable in cloud technology especially AWS and python. They must be innovative, competent and comfortable in challenging status quo.


What Technologies are they required to know The suitable candidate must be highly proficient in the use of:

Jenkins (scripted and declarative pipelines)

Python(2 and 3)

Python frameworks (Flask/Django)

Terraform (0.11 and 0.12)

AWS (Most of AWS including ECS,EKS)

Kubernetes

Ansible (2.2 and 2.8)

Linux tools

Artifactory

Swarm

Docker

Harshicorp vault

Groovy (for jenkinsfiles)

Custom ansible frameworks

Mandatory Technical Skills

Must have Programming experience (not just scripting), in addition to skills using above technologies.


Desirable Technical Skills Object Oriented programming, DDD, TDD, EDA and any extra skills would be nice.


Mandatory Business Skills Good written and verbal communication skills; Expectation setting, client relations, Proactive, Problem Solving and creativity skills; Honesty and integrity.


Desirable Business Skills Knowledge of HMRC business